What is Usability and Why Does it Matter?
Usability is a measure that describes how easily users can achieve their goals with a given product. It’s best understood by examining its five fundamental components that collectively define user experience:
Learnability refers to the ease with which an average person can navigate and command a product during their first interaction. This component is crucial for digital interfaces as it determines whether users can quickly understand your system without extensive training.
Memorability measures how well a user can continue to work with the product after an extended period of non-use. For websites and mobile apps, this translates to intuitive navigation and consistent design patterns that stick in users’ minds.
Efficiency evaluates the amount of effort required to accomplish tasks once users have become familiar with the design. This component directly impacts user satisfaction and business objectives by reducing the time and clicks required to complete actions.
Satisfaction pertains to whether users enjoy the product’s design and find the experience pleasant. High satisfaction scores often correlate with increased customer loyalty and positive word-of-mouth marketing.
Errors are mistakes that bring a user’s journey to a standstill. Depending on the severity of the error, users may persevere with your product or seek more user-friendly alternatives.

Understanding Usability Testing
Usability testing is the systematic process of evaluating a product by testing it with representative users from your target audience. This human-centered design approach involves observing real people as they attempt to complete tasks using your prototype or live product.
During these sessions, UX designers and usability engineers gather both qualitative and quantitative data to understand what helps and what hinders the user experience. This user research method reveals critical insights about human-computer interaction that can’t be discovered through internal reviews or assumptions.
The primary goal is to identify usability issues before they become costly problems, ensuring your digital content and interactive systems meet user expectations and business requirements.
Types of Usability Testing Methods
Moderated vs. Unmoderated Testing
Moderated usability testing involves a facilitator guiding participants through tasks while observing their behavior and asking follow-up questions to gather feedback. This method provides rich qualitative insights and allows for immediate clarification of user feedback.
Unmoderated testing allows participants to complete tasks independently, often using specialized software that records their sessions. This approach is more cost-effective and can accommodate larger sample sizes, making it ideal for gathering quantitative data.
Remote vs. In-Person Testing
Remote usability testing has become increasingly popular, allowing researchers to test with participants regardless of geographic location. This method reduces development costs and enables testing with a more diverse user base.
In-person testing provides the advantage of observing non-verbal cues and creating a controlled environment, but may be limited by logistical constraints.
Exploratory, Assessment, and Comparative Testing
Exploratory tests are conducted in early development stages to understand user behaviors and validate preliminary design concepts. These sessions help UX designers identify potential issues before significant resources are invested.
Assessment testing occurs during mid-development to evaluate specific features and measure performance against predetermined success criteria.
Comparative testing contrasts different design versions or benchmarks your product against competitors, providing valuable insights for strategic decisions.
Advanced Usability Testing Techniques
Beyond traditional methods, modern usability testing incorporates sophisticated approaches that provide deeper insights into user behavior:
Eye-tracking studies reveal where users focus their attention on digital interfaces, helping UX designers optimize layout and visual hierarchy. This technique is particularly valuable for understanding how users scan web pages and identify areas that may be overlooked.
A/B testing integration allows you to validate usability improvements with real traffic data. By combining qualitative usability insights with quantitative performance metrics, you can make data-driven decisions that improve both user satisfaction and business outcomes.
Accessibility testing ensures your digital products are usable by people with disabilities, expanding your potential audience while meeting legal compliance requirements. This specialized form of usability testing examines how assistive technologies interact with your interface.
Cognitive walkthroughs involve experts systematically evaluating each step users must take to complete tasks, identifying potential confusion points before live testing begins. This method is particularly effective during early design phases when prototypes may not yet support full user interactions.
When Should You Conduct Usability Tests?
Usability testing should be integrated throughout the entire development lifecycle, rather than being treated as a one-time activity. Here’s when to implement testing for maximum impact:
Early Stage: Wireframe Testing
The first round of usability testing occurs after creating wireframes of your website or web app. At this stage, you can validate the information architecture and basic user flows without incurring significant costs for visual design or development.
Mid-Development: Prototype Testing
When you have a clickable prototype, conduct more comprehensive testing to evaluate user interface design and interaction patterns. Prototyping tools enable the creation of realistic testing scenarios while maintaining development flexibility.
Pre-Launch: Comprehensive Testing
Before going live, perform thorough usability tests that simulate real-world usage scenarios. This stage should include testing across different devices, browsers, and user contexts.
Post-Launch: Continuous Optimization
After launch, ongoing usability testing helps optimize existing features and validate new functionality. Regular testing ensures that your digital interfaces continue to meet evolving user expectations.
How to Conduct Effective Usability Tests
1. Define Clear Objectives
Start by establishing specific, measurable goals for your usability testing. Consider questions like: What aspects of the user experience need improvement? Which features are causing user frustration? How can we better align with business objectives?
2. Select Your Testing Focus
Identify specific areas of your website or application that you want to test. For example, if you’re testing an e-commerce platform, focus on critical user journeys, such as product discovery, cart management, and checkout processes. Similarly, construction company websites require testing of project showcases and contact forms, while medical practice websites need to be evaluated for their appointment booking systems and patient information access.
3. Choose the Right Methodology
Select testing methods that align with your objectives and development stage. Consider your available resources, timeline, and the type of insights you need to gather.
4. Set Success Thresholds
Establish quantitative benchmarks for success before testing begins. This might include task completion rates, time-on-task metrics, or user satisfaction scores using standardized scales.
5. Recruit Representative Participants
Find participants who genuinely represent your target audience. While testing with colleagues might seem convenient, it often introduces bias that skews results. Aim for 5-8 participants per testing round to achieve an optimal insight-to-effort ratio.
6. Create Realistic Test Scenarios
Design tasks that mirror real-world usage patterns. Avoid leading questions and ensure scenarios feel natural to participants.
7. Analyze and Act on Results
Conduct thorough data analysis to identify patterns and prioritize areas for improvement. Look for both quantitative trends and qualitative themes that emerge from user feedback.

Mobile Usability Testing: A Critical Consideration
With mobile devices accounting for over 50% of web traffic, mobile usability testing has become indispensable for comprehensive user experience evaluation. Mobile testing presents unique challenges that desktop testing doesn’t address.
Touch interaction patterns differ significantly from mouse-based navigation. Mobile usability testing reveals how users interact with touchscreens, including tap accuracy, swipe gestures, and pinch-to-zoom behaviors. These insights inform decisions about button sizing, spacing, and the placement of interactive elements.
The context of use for mobile devices varies dramatically from desktop scenarios. Users often browse on mobile while multitasking, in poor lighting conditions, or with limited attention spans. Testing should account for these real-world usage patterns.
Device fragmentation creates additional complexity, as user experiences can vary significantly across different screen sizes, operating systems, and device capabilities. Comprehensive mobile testing includes multiple device types and screen resolutions.
Performance considerations become increasingly critical on mobile devices, where slower network connections and limited processing power can significantly impact usability. Testing should evaluate not just interface design but also loading times and responsiveness.
Cross-platform consistency ensures that users have a familiar experience, whether they access your site via desktop, mobile browser, or native applications. Testing across platforms reveals inconsistencies that might confuse or frustrate users.

Common Usability Testing Mistakes to Avoid
Many organizations make critical errors that undermine their testing efforts:
- Testing too late in the development process, making changes expensive and difficult to implement
- Leading participants with suggestive questions that bias responses
- Focusing solely on quantitative data while ignoring valuable qualitative insights
- Testing with inadequate sample sizes that don’t provide statistical significance
- Failing to act on results renders the entire testing exercise meaningless
Best Practices for Documentation and Analysis
Effective usability testing requires systematic documentation:
- Save audio and video recordings (with participant consent) for detailed analysis
- Use screen recorders to capture exact user interactions
- Prepare standardized scripts to ensure consistent testing conditions
- Document non-verbal cues that provide additional context
- Conduct pre- and post-test surveys to measure changes in user perception
